Julian McMahon, Graham Norton and Joan Rivers on The Graham Norton Show

Graham Norton discusses surgery secrets of the stars with Joan Rivers and Julian McMahon



Graham Norton continues the first season of his new prime-time series tonight on Â鶹Éç Two when he discusses surgery secrets of the stars with legendary Emmy award-winning actress, writer, comedienne and red carpet queen Joan Rivers and Nip/Tuck star, actor Julian McMahon.

Ìý

Joan, famously no stranger to the surgeon's knife herself, gives her typically strident views on plastic surgery:

Ìý

"I'd like to look down but I can't ... everyone's done it ... all those gorgeous women, they've all had itsy bitsy bits done [but] they all lie, I get crazy when they lie ... it's all about lips, t*ts and a**e, every woman should put the money on herself, of course you want to feel better about yourself."

Ìý

On the sartorial hits and misses of this year's Oscars: "Penelope Cruz was the prettiest ... the worst were Nicole Kidman, she looked like a ketchup bottle, and Meryl Streep, I adore her but she looked like a Chinese lesbian."

Ìý

On how Hollywood's finest achieve their waif-like beauty: "They're very thin and smell of vomit, I don't shake their right hands. Everyone does botox, it's the new diet; they can't open their mouths."

Ìý

And on why Heather McCartney Mills gets her vote for smartest woman in the world: "To get him not to sign a pre-nup – she must have a trick pelvis like we don't understand!"

Ìý

Julian McMahon reveals that his role as a doctor in Nip/Tuck has led to some unusual approaches: "You get many different kinds of proposals – 'would you like to sleep with my wife and give her a boob job at the same time'."

Ìý

He reveals he is set to star in another two seasons of the hit US drama.

Ìý

The Graham Norton Show is a So Television production for Â鶹Éç Two.

Ìý

The Graham Norton Show, Thursday 8 March 2007, 10.00pm, Â鶹Éç Two (extended repeat Sunday, 11.20pm)
